What Causes Red Lumps Along With Severe Itching In The Vagina?
I am 61, slim and reasonably fit - I have had discomfort and itching around the vagina for more than 3 months - it seems worse at night. There is no abnormal discharge and no pain during urination. When examining myself to look at sitr of itching I noticed 4 soft pink nodules just inside the back wall of the vagina. I had an episiotomy 30 years ago for my first child which resulted in some scar tissue but I dont remember seeing these pink nodules before. Thanks

Hi Thank you for asking HCM I have gone through your query. Your problem can be due to bartholinitis. A vaginal examination by gynecologist and swab will be helpful to rule out the condition. Hot fomentation will give some relief. But if infection is there then antibiotics will be required. For such case i usually advise vaginal suppositories with combination of clindamycin and clotrimazole. Using intimate wash regularly will be helpful in normalizing vaginal bacterial flora and PH and there by prevent getting further infections. Hope this may help you. Let me know if anything not clear.
